I gave this a 5 star for food, not because it was fancy, delicate, unique, etc... but because it seemed like authentic family style Nicaraguan food. I'm not Nicaraguan so I might now know what I'm talking about. I'll say this though... the place had at least 10 food delivery service bikes outside, another 20 people or so waiting for take out food, and it was packed with local family and friends. Even so, it's large and we were given a table right away. It abounds with choices. Mostly you order each dish you want individually. The prices are quite affordable. The food is TASTY! I ordered enchiladas- they weren't what I expected- more like empinadas but they were so good and better then I expected. This is one of the places you will walk out of stuffed because you'll want to try everything. The grilled plantains were ... OMG amazing!!! Please stop by this place if you are in the area. If you like the buz of humanity and authentic food and experience, you'll be thrilled.
